MicroSectors U.S. Big Banks 3X Leveraged ETNs (NYSEARCA:BNKU – Get Free Report) was the recipient of a significant drop in short interest during the month of February. As of February 27th, there was short interest totaling 19,416 shares, a drop of 16.0% from the February 12th total of 23,123 shares. Approximately 12.1% of the company’s stock are short sold.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 28,169 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.7 days. MicroSectors U.S. Big Banks 3X Leveraged ETNs Trading Down 0.3%
Shares of BNKU traded down $0.07 on Wednesday, reaching $24.60. The company’s stock had a trading volume of 4,619 shares, compared to its average volume of 23,454. MicroSectors U.S. Big Banks 3X Leveraged ETNs has a twelve month low of $8.51 and a twelve month high of $40.76. The stock has a market capitalization of $3.94 million, a PE ratio of 14.27 and a beta of -5.19. The firm has a fifty day moving average of $32.43 and a 200-day moving average of $30.01.
